Giorgia Meloni and Her Impact on Italian Politics

On October 2, 2025

Introduction

Giorgia Meloni, the leader of Italy’s Brothers of Italy party, has made headlines as the first female Prime Minister of Italy since the post-war era. Her ascent to power is significant not only for gender representation in Italian politics but also for the broader implications her leadership has on Italy’s political landscape and European Union dynamics.

Recent Developments

Since taking office in October 2022, Meloni’s government has focused on key issues such as economic recovery, migration, and national security. Her administration has proposed measures to address the rising cost of living, particularly in the wake of recessions influenced by the COVID-19 pandemic and ongoing geopolitical tensions. Meloni’s coalition government, which includes the far-right League party and the center-right Forza Italia, has sought to present a united front amidst various challenges.

One of Meloni’s hallmark policies is her position on immigration. She advocates for stricter controls and has supported legislation that aims to limit the entry of migrants into Italy. This stance has resonated with segments of the Italian population concerned about the economic impacts of migration. Critics, however, argue that her policies may exacerbate humanitarian issues in the Mediterranean.

In terms of foreign policy, Meloni has signaled a pro-European Union stance while maintaining her party’s nationalist ideology. She has voiced support for Ukraine amidst the ongoing conflict with Russia, aligning with fellow Western leaders. Her administration’s approach balances national interests within the scope of EU regulations and collective agreements.

Public Reception

Public opinion on Meloni remains mixed. Support for her government is notably high among her political base, reflecting a significant shift to the right in Italian politics. However, opponents express concern over her government’s direction, particularly regarding social policies and civil rights. Demonstrations have taken place across the country, reflecting a portion of the population’s apprehension towards her administration.
